Article Name : | | PLASMONIC BEHAVIOR OF ALUMINIUM-BASED NANOSTRUCTURES | Author Name : | | Pushpa Beerappa Pujar D/O Beerappa Pujar and Dr. Neeraj Panwar | Publisher : | | Ashok Yakkaldevi | Article Series No. : | | ROR-16234 | Article : | |  | Author Profile | Abstract : | | Plasmonics, the study of collective oscillations of free electrons in metallic nanostructures, has emerged as a vital field for advancing photonic and optoelectronic technologies. While noble metals such as gold and silver have traditionally dominated plasmonic research due to their favorable optical properties, their limitations in cost, abundance, and compatibility with complementary metal–oxide–semiconductor (CMOS) technology have stimulated interest in alternative materials. | Keywords : | | - Plasmonics,Aluminium nanostructures,
